Объединяйте и разделяйте документы с легкостью

Объединяйте различные типы документов без проблем.

Легко управляйте документами, разбивая большие файлы на более мелкие и удобные части.

Управляйте страницами документа, изменяя их порядок, меняя местами или удаляя их.

Краткий обзор GroupDocs.Merger

API для объединения, разделения, замены, изменения порядка или удаления страниц документов, слайдов и диаграмм.

  • Объединение нескольких форматов файлов

    Легко объединяйте несколько PDF, Office и многих других поддерживаемых форматов в один документ.

  • Разделение больших документов

    Разделяйте документы по определенным страницам, диапазонам или даже извлекайте отдельные страницы.

  • Настройка структуры документа

    Организуйте свои документы, переставляя, удаляя или добавляя страницы.

  • Предварительный просмотр страниц документа

    Создавайте изображения страниц документа, чтобы лучше понять их содержимое и структуру.

Практическая демонстрация кода

Некоторые типичные варианты использования GroupDocs.Merger.

Объединение нескольких файлов

GroupDocs.Merger позволяет объединить несколько файлов в один файл. Вы можете объединить целые документы или отдельные страницы ваших документов.
//  Укажите желаемые номера страниц или диапазон страниц для присоединения.
PageJoinOptions joinOptions = new PageJoinOptions(1, 4, RangeMode.OddPages);

// Загрузите исходный файл DOCX
using (Merger merger = new Merger(@"c:\sample1.docx"))
{
  // Добавьте еще один файл DOCX для объединения
  merger.Join(@"c:\sample2.docx", joinOptions);
  
  // Объедините файлы DOCX и сохраните результат
  merger.Save(@"c:\merged.docx");
}
//  Укажите желаемые номера страниц или диапазон страниц для присоединения.
JoinOptions joinOptions = new JoinOptions(1, 4, RangeMode.OddPages);

// Загрузите исходный файл DOCX
Merger merger = new Merger("c:\sample1.docx");
  
// Добавьте еще один файл DOCX для объединения
merger.join("c:\sample2.docx", joinOptions);

// Объедините файлы DOCX и сохраните результат
merger.save("c:\merged.docx");
//  Укажите желаемые номера страниц или диапазон страниц для присоединения.
const joinOptions = new JoinOptions(1, 4, RangeMode.OddPages);

// Загрузите исходный файл DOCX
const merger = new Merger("c:\sample1.docx");
  
// Добавьте еще один файл DOCX для объединения
merger.join("c:\sample2.docx", joinOptions);

// Объедините файлы DOCX и сохраните результат
merger.save("c:\merged.docx");
import groupdocs.merger as gm

def run():

    #  Укажите желаемые номера страниц или диапазон страниц для присоединения.
    joinOptions = gm.domain.options.JoinOptions(1, 4, gm.RangeMode.OddPages)

    # Загрузите исходный файл DOCX
    with gm.Merger("c:\sample1.docx") as merger:

        # Добавьте еще один файл DOCX для объединения
        merger.join("c:\sample2.docx", joinOptions)

        # Объедините файлы DOCX и сохраните результат
        merger.save("c:\merged.docx")

Поддерживается 60+ форматов файлов

GroupDocs.Merger поддерживает операции с широким спектром форматов документов.

Ключевые метрики и статистические данные

Ознакомьтесь с подробной разбивкой наших ключевых показателей, предоставив комплексные показатели и статистическую информацию о наших достижениях, влиянии и росте.

  • 60+

    Поддерживаемые форматы

    Каждая библиотека поддерживает обработку более 50 наиболее популярных форматов файлов и документов.

  • 274k

    Загрузки NuGet

    GroupDocs.Merger для .NET имеет более 274 тысяч загрузок из диспетчера пакетов NuGet.

  • 5.5k

    Загрузки Maven

    GroupDocs.Merger для Java имеет более 5,5 тысяч загрузок из нашего репозитория Maven.

  • 140+

    Счастливые клиенты

    Нашими библиотеками пользуются как небольшие индивидуальные разработчики, так и ведущие компании по всему миру.

Наши счастливые клиенты

Библиотеки GroupDocs используются всемирно известными и выдающимися брендами по всему миру.

Независимость от платформы

Библиотека GroupDocs.Merger поддерживает следующие операционные системы и платформы:

.NET

.NET Framework 4.6.2 или выше
.NET Core 2.0 или выше
.NET 6.0 или выше
Mono Framework 2.6.7 или выше
Windows, Линукс, Мак ОС
Microsoft Visual Studio
Xamarin (Android, iOS, Mac)
MonoDevelop
Более 60 форматов файлов

Java

J2SE 8.0 или выше
Windows, Линукс, Мак ОС
IntelliJ IDEA
Eclipse
NetBeans
Более 50 форматов файлов

Node.js

Node.js 16+ и J2SE 8.0 (1,8) +
Windows, Linux, Mac OS
Atom
Visual Studio Code
Любой другой текстовый редактор
Более 50 форматов файлов

Python

Python 3.9+
и .Net 6+
Windows, Linux, Mac OS
IDLE
PyCharm
Visual Studio Code
Более 50 форматов файлов

Готовы начать?

Попробуйте функции GroupDocs.Merger бесплатно на своей платформе

Часто задаваемые вопросы

Ответы на наиболее часто задаваемые вопросы.

  • Требуется ли библиотеке GroupDocs.Merger какое-либо другое стороннее программное обеспечение для управления документами?
    GroupDocs.Merger не требует установки какого-либо внешнего программного обеспечения, такого как Adobe Acrobat, Microsoft Office или любого другого.
  • Могу ли я попробовать библиотеку GroupDocs.Merger перед ее покупкой?
    Да, вы можете попробовать GroupDocs.Merger без покупки лицензии. После установки без лицензии библиотека работает в пробном режиме. В этом режиме к полученному документу добавляются пробные значки, и он обрезается до первых трех страниц. Если вы хотите протестировать GroupDocs.Merger без ограничений пробной версии, вы также можете запросить 30-дневную временную лицензию. Более подробную информацию см. в разделе Получить временную лицензию.
  • Какие лицензии у вас есть?
    Мы предлагаем несколько типов лицензий, соответствующих потребностям конкретных разработчиков или компаний. Типы лицензий зависят от количества разработчиков, количества расположений сайтов разработчиков и от того, нужно ли вам доставлять наш SDK/API конечным клиентам. Альтернативно вы можете выбрать лимитные лицензии, основанные на ежемесячном использовании продукта. Подробную информацию можно найти на странице Типы лицензий.

GroupDocs.Merger облачные API

Ускорьте объединение документов в приложениях любого типа с помощью нашего облачного REST API.

GroupDocs.Merger приложений NoCode

Онлайн-приложение, позволяющее объединять и разделять более 170 популярных форматов файлов в браузере.

 Русский